Strings with commas were excluded from checks because yamllint had false
positives for flow style maps and sequences which need quotes when
values contain commas. This issue has been fixed as of the 1.34 release,
so drop the work-around.

Document established Devicetree bindings maintainers review practice:
1. Device node names should not be treated as an ABI, unless for
children of a device when documented.
There were many patches posted using of_find_node_by_name() or
of_node_name_eq() for accessing siblings or completely different
nodes. These cases were introducing undocumented ABI, so they are
discouraged.
2. 'simple-mfd' means children do not depend on parent device resources.
'simple-bus' is so simple, that even 'reg' properties are not
applicable.

Add vf610 reboot controller, which used to reboot whole system. Fix below
CHECK_DTB warnings:
arch/arm/boot/dts/nxp/vf/vf610-bk4.dtb: /soc/bus@40000000/src@4006e000:
failed to match any schema with compatible: ['fsl,vf610-src', 'syscon']
IC reference manual calls it as system reset controller(SRC), but it is not
module as reset controller, which used to reset individual device. SRC
works as reboot controller, which reboots whole system. It provides a
syscon interface to syscon-reboot.

Remove the implementation of use_carrier, the link monitoring
method that utilizes ethtool or ioctl to determine the link state of an
interface in a bond. Bonding will always behaves as if use_carrier=1,
which relies on netif_carrier_ok() to determine the link state of
interfaces.
To avoid acquiring RTNL many times per second, bonding inspects
link state under RCU, but not under RTNL. However, ethtool
implementations in drivers may sleep, and therefore this strategy is
unsuitable for use with calls into driver ethtool functions.
The use_carrier option was introduced in 2003, to provide
backwards compatibility for network device drivers that did not support
the then-new netif_carrier_ok/on/off system. Device drivers are now
expected to support netif_carrier_*, and the use_carrier backwards
compatibility logic is no longer necessary.
The option itself remains, but when queried always returns 1,
and may only be set to 1.

For some Ethernet controllers, the PTP timer function is not integrated.
Instead, the PTP timer is a separate device and provides PTP Hardware
Clock (PHC) to the Ethernet controller to use, such as NXP FMan MAC,
ENETC, etc. Therefore, a property is needed to indicate this hardware
relationship between the Ethernet controller and the PTP timer.
Since this use case is also very common, it is better to add a generic
property to ethernet-controller.yaml. According to the existing binding
docs, there are two good candidates, one is the "ptp-timer" defined in
fsl,fman-dtsec.yaml, and the other is the "ptimer-handle" defined in
fsl,fman.yaml. From the perspective of the name, the former is more
straightforward, so move the "ptp-timer" from fsl,fman-dtsec.yaml to
ethernet-controller.yaml.

NXP NETC (Ethernet Controller) is a multi-function PCIe Root Complex
Integrated Endpoint (RCiEP), the Timer is one of its functions which
provides current time with nanosecond resolution, precise periodic
pulse, pulse on timeout (alarm), and time capture on external pulse
support. And also supports time synchronization as required for IEEE
1588 and IEEE 802.1AS-2020. So add device tree binding doc for the PTP
clock based on NETC Timer.
NETC Timer has three reference clock sources, but the clock mux is inside
the IP. Therefore, the driver will parse the clock name to select the
desired clock source. If the clocks property is not present, NETC Timer
will use the system clock of NETC IP as its reference clock. Because the
Timer is a PCIe function of NETC IP, the system clock of NETC is always
available to the Timer.

Since the introduction of pid namespaces, their interaction with procfs
has been entirely implicit in ways that require a lot of dancing around
by programs that need to construct sandboxes with different PID
namespaces.
Being able to explicitly specify the pid namespace to use when
constructing a procfs super block will allow programs to no longer need
to fork off a process which does then does unshare(2) / setns(2) and
forks again in order to construct a procfs in a pidns.
So, provide a "pidns" mount option which allows such users to just
explicitly state which pid namespace they want that procfs instance to
use. This interface can be used with fsconfig(2) either with a file
descriptor or a path:
fsconfig(procfd, FSCONFIG_SET_FD, "pidns", NULL, nsfd);
fsconfig(procfd, FSCONFIG_SET_STRING, "pidns", "/proc/self/ns/pid", 0);
or with classic mount(2) / mount(8):
// mount -t proc -o pidns=/proc/self/ns/pid proc /tmp/proc
mount("proc", "/tmp/proc", "proc", MS_..., "pidns=/proc/self/ns/pid");
As this new API is effectively shorthand for setns(2) followed by
mount(2), the permission model for this mirrors pidns_install() to avoid
opening up new attack surfaces by loosening the existing permission
model.
In order to avoid having to RCU-protect all users of proc_pid_ns() (to
avoid UAFs), attempting to reconfigure an existing procfs instance's pid
namespace will error out with -EBUSY. Creating new procfs instances is
quite cheap, so this should not be an impediment to most users, and lets
us avoid a lot of churn in fs/proc/* for a feature that it seems
unlikely userspace would use.

Samsung S3C24xx family of SoCs was removed from the Linux kernel in the
commit 61b7f8920b ("ARM: s3c: remove all s3c24xx support"), in January
2023. There are no in-kernel users of its compatibles.

Commit 2677010e77 ("Add support to set NAPI threaded for individual
NAPI") introduced threaded NAPI configuration per individual NAPI
instance, however obsolete description that threaded NAPI is per device
has remained.
Remove the old description and clarify that only NAPI instances running
in threaded mode spawn kernel threads by changing "Each NAPI instance"
to "Each threaded NAPI instance".

Depending on which display that is connected to the controller, an "1"
means either a black or a white pixel.
The supported formats (R1/R2/XRGB8888) expects the pixels
to map against (4bit):
00 => Black
01 => Dark Gray
10 => Light Gray
11 => White
If this is not what the display map against, the controller has support
to invert these values.

Rework the PowerVR Rogue GPU binding to use an explicit, per variant
style for defining power domain properties and add support for the
T-HEAD TH1520 SoC's GPU.
To improve clarity and precision, the binding is refactored so that
power domain items are listed explicitly for each variant [1]. The
previous method relied on an implicit, positional mapping between the
`power-domains` and `power-domain-names` properties. This change
replaces the generic rules with self contained if/then blocks for each
GPU variant, making the relationship between power domains and their
names explicit and unambiguous.
The generic if block for img,img-rogue, which previously required
power-domains and power-domain-names for all variants, is removed.
Instead, each specific GPU variant now defines its own power domain
requirements within a self-contained if/then block, making the schema
more explicit.
This new structure is then used to add support for the
`thead,th1520-gpu`. While its BXM-4-64 IP has two conceptual power
domains, the TH1520 SoC integrates them behind a single power gate. The
new binding models this with a specific rule that enforces a single
`power-domains` entry and disallows the `power-domain-names` property.
